On an unbearably hot, humid August night, five men: three crude Southern old-timers, a real estate investor from Salt Lake City, and a young African-American, gather at Horace Moore’s small, derelict house in the backwoods of Western Kentucky for a casual night of cards and conversation. The conversation begins with Kimball and Horace discussing the sale of his land to an investment firm before being joined by the others. But, as the conversation moves deeper into the night, some of the men begin to share secrets and they discover that the past isn’t dead but they are continually haunted by the remnants of the past. absorbed into night explores those places in our memories that are immune to temporal and geographic distance to show that sometimes, the real traumas and nightmares we experience are not imagined narratives, but those real, first-hand experiences that refuse to remain hidden.
